Nigerian billionaire and politician, Ned Nwoko, has shared a personal story about his marriage to actress Regina Daniels, revealing that his youngest wife turned down multiple high-profile suitors to be with him. Speaking during a casual meal with friends and colleagues, Nwoko opened up about Daniels’ life before their marriage and the suitors who tried to win her over.
Nwoko, who has been married to Daniels for a few years, said that the young actress was in high demand before they met, with several prominent figures vying for her attention. According to him, she received gifts from an array of suitors, including wealthy oil magnates and even pastors. “She told me there were many suitors, including pastors, oil magnates, but she said yes to me,” Nwoko revealed to his audience, highlighting the extent of the attention Daniels had received.
The politician’s comments underscored the fact that despite the lavish gifts and advances from these other men, Regina Daniels chose to be with him. “She is a gem,” Nwoko said, praising his wife for her decision to commit to him over the other wealthy and influential suitors.
Regina Daniels, who gained fame in her teenage years for her acting career, married Nwoko in 2019 when she was just 20 years old. The union, which sparked much public interest due to their age difference, has been the subject of frequent media attention. Despite the scrutiny, both Nwoko and Daniels have remained steadfast in their commitment to each other, often sharing glimpses of their lives on social media.
In recent years, Regina has continued to build her career, balancing her acting profession with her roles as a wife and mother. Nwoko, for his part, has been active in politics and philanthropy, with a focus on development projects in his home state of Delta.
